Autoship Reward Points: A "loyalty program" awarding points to Members who maintain an Autoship order over consecutive months. Each point equals a dollar of free PV that the Member may redeem for products. Points roll over from month to month and only expire if Autoship is discontinued. Click here for more details. Commissionable Products: Products on which commissions are paid. (Non-commissionable products include such items as business aids and accessories.) Customer: A Member who purchases products at 24% above the wholesale price, does not have an Autoship order, and does not participate in the Young Living business opportunity. Customers are placed on the sponsor's level, and contribute to the sponsor's PV. Customers do not occupy a place in the downline organization apart from their sponsor's place. Customer Earnings: A commission of 24% of sales volume generated by Customers to their sponsors. Director Team Bonus: The second part of the Distributor Team Performance Bonus program rewarding a Distributor an extra $1500 monthly bonus for creating and/or maintaining each month a Manager team structure that has two additional Manager team structures on its first level, thus completing the Director team structure. Downline Organization:
The total number of Members (Distributors
and Customers) enrolled under you, beginning with your first
level and continuing to infinite levels. Dynamic Compression: An
order of 50 PV is considered a "qualifying" order, meaning that it qualifies
to be counted as a level in the downline organization on which a Distributor
gets paid. Where a Distributor in your downline organization has less than 50 PV
in a given month, that person's PV compresses
up to the level above it, and further downline volume compresses up
until a "qualifying" order of 50PV fills the original spot. You are
paid commmissions on all the compressed volume. Enroller:
A Distributor who enrolls a new Member in Young Living. Generation:
A generation consists of all Members in one leg of a downline organization
between two Silver (or higher rank) Distributors. The generation begins with a
Silver and extends down to, but does not include
the next Silver or above. The next generation begins with the next Silver Distributor
in that same leg in the downline organization.
Generations are not limited by levels and may extend virtually to infinite
levels of depth in a leg where no other Silver Distributors appear in the downline organization. Generation Bonus: A
Bonus paid in addition to all other commissions and bonuses to Distributors who have achieved the rank of
Silver or above. When you become a Silver, the Bonus is 3% and is paid on all sales volume in your downline organization down to,
but not including, the next Silver or above in any leg. If no Silver appears in a
leg, the bonus is paid on the entire leg as far as it goes. When other Distributors in your downline
organization achieve the rank of Silver, you are paid 4% on their generations. Leg: A
"leg" begins with a Distributor on your first level and includes all the
Members (Distributors and Customers) who are enrolled underneath
that person. Level: When
a new person is enrolled in Young Living, he or she is sponsored under
a Distributor and is considered "First Level" to that Distributor. Someone
placed under that person would be the original Distributor's Second Level,
and so on. Manager Team Bonus:
A bonus of $500 paid to a Distributor
who meets specific qualifications: a 100PV Autoship, 1000
PGV, 6 personally-enrolled first-level Distributors
(each with 100PV Autoship orders), 2 of those 6 Distributors are
"Team Captains" with 1000PGV and enroll their own 6 first-level Distributors who
have 100PV Autoship orders. Matching Bonus:
A bonus paid to you that matches
the Star Bonus paid to your personally
enrolled new Distributors during the first three months of the new Distributor's
enrollment. If they earn the Star Bonus in month 1 and 2, you
receive a matching bonus for those first two consecutive months, but nothing
in the third month. If they earn the Star Bonus in month 2 and 3, you
receive a matching bonus for those 2 months. Member:
A Distributor or Customer who buys directly from Young Living
Essential Oils. Month End:
Month End is the cutoff date for processing online, phone, fax, and postal orders.
The cutoff is midnight Mountain Time on the last calendar day of the month.
To be included in commissions for a month, mailed-in orders must be received
by the last business day of that month. Organization Group Volume (OGV):
The total sales volume of your
entire organization, including PV, Customers and Distributors. Personal Volume (PV):
The value (usually equal to the
wholesale price) of products purchased by a Distributor and/or his/her personally sponsored Customers
and Preferred Customers.
Preferred Customer: A
Customer who maintains an Autoship order of at least 50PV and thus qualifies
to purchase products at 12% above the wholesale price. Preferred Customers are placed
on the sponsor's level, and contribute to the sponsor's PV. Preferred Customers do not occupy a place
in the downline organization apart from their sponsor's place.
Preferred Customer Earnings:
A commission of 12% of sales volume generated by Preferred Customers to their sponsors.
Preferred Customer Performance Bonus:
A bonus paid monthly, in addition to all other commissions
and bonuses, rewarding Distributors for building a three-stage
Customer/Distributor structure in which all
Members maintain a minimum 50PV Autoship order: Stage 1) 6 personally sponsored Preferred Customers,
Stage 2) 2 personally sponsored Distributors who sponsor 6 Preferred Customers,
and Stage 3) the two personally sponsored Distributors sponsor 2 Distributors who sponsor
6 Preferred Customers.
Meeting the Stage 1 Qualfications earns $100,
Stage 2 earns $200, and Stage 3 earns $500, totalling
$800 maximum Bonus for each three-stage structure maintained.
Professional Discount:
(As of March 1, 2006) Individual or business Customers who give proof of their business status (e.g., License, EIN, etc.) to YLEO may purchase products at a special discounted rate: Orders of 500-999.99 PV are discounted 24% of Customer Price; orders over 1000PV are discounted 27% of Customer Price. Commissions on discounted sales are calculated on 50% of the PV.
Rank: An
achievement level of sales and leg development qualifying a
Distributor to earn a range of commissions and bonuses according to the
compensation plan. There are 9 Ranks.
Sponsor: The
Distributor under whom a new Member is placed. Unless specified otherwise,
the Enroller is also the Sponsor.
Star Bonus:
A bonus paid to you on the purchases made by your personally enrolled new Distributors
for their first two consecutive months of business: 25% for the first month
and15% for the second. You must have 50PV the first month and an autoship of
50PV in the second month to qualify. The maximum Star bonus paid in any one month
on any one Distributor is $200. Note: Distributors upline from a Distributor who makes the Star
Bonus will earn their Unilevel 5% commission on only 50% of the PV of the new Distributor's orders.
Unilevel: The
Unilevel part of the compensation plan covers the first 5 levels of your
downline organization, paying out 5% on the purchases of all the Members
in those levels, according to your Achievement Level. See the Compensation
Plan Diagram for details.
Wholesale Price:
The price paid for products by Distributors.
